If a tool is performing poorly or leaking, a complete overhaul may be necessary.

 

 

Perform overhaul in a clean, well lit area using care not to scratch or nick any smooth surface that comes in contact with an o'ring. 

Use of Lubriplate® #630

-

AA (Gage Bilt part no. 402723) or equivalent during reassembly to prevent tearing or distorting of o'rings.

 

 

 1.  Disconnect air supply. 

 

 

 2.  Disconnect hydraulic coupler

-

male (585047) from power supply and tubing

-

air (700307) from pump. 

 

 

 3.  Remove hydraulic coupler

-

male (585047) from reducer bushing (403431) and drain hydraulic hose (A

-

317) into an approved container.

 

 

 4.  Remove fitting from follower (see nose assembly data sheet). 

 

 

 5.  Remove complete nose assembly and extensions from tool. 

 

 

 6.  Remove four button head cap screws (402479) separating handle assembly (700347) from head cylinder assembly (703150).

 

 

 7.  Replace o

ring (S832) and gasket (704129). 

 

 

 8.  Remove end cap (703114) and carefully push piston (703607) out of head cylinder assembly (703150). 

 

 

   

 9.  Using a small blunt object, remove polyseal (405865) and o

ring (400788) from piston (703607) and o

rings (S834) and back

-

up 

   

 

 ring (401089) from inside head cylinder assembly (703150).

 

 

10. Reassembly sequence is opposite of disassembly. Be sure relative positions of o'rings and back

-

up rings are as shown in 

 

 

 exploded view and part list. 

 

 

Coat hose fitting threads with a non

-

hardening Teflon® thread compound such as Slic

-

tite® (Gage Bilt part no. 403237). DO NOT USE 

TEFLON® TAPE.

TOOL DISPOSAL

 

1.

 

When tool life is met, drain hydraulic oil from tool and dispose of the hydraulic oil in accordance with the safety datasheet.

 

 

2.

 

Disassemble tool and remove all rubber o

rings, seals, wipers and hydraulic hoses. All tool materials are recyclable except rubber 

o

rings, seals, wipers and hydraulic hoses. Dispose of rubber materials in accordance with the material safety datasheet.
